Announcing a "Returning Practitioner"

Northwest Neurodevelopmental Training Center has gone through a lot of changes through the years. Since our practitioner's had decided in May 2009, that they were venturing out on their own to start their own practice, we have been in a huge transition of what will happen to the center now? But help is on the rise!

Susan Scott, a former practitioner to the center, will be returning as an independent contractor to see clients and do some in house training. Her educational background is a BA in Liberal Arts, Philosophy, and English Lit.

Susan Scott started in the center 18 years ago, in 1991, and has graciously stated that she will come and see clients here for us by appointment.

Susan trained under the tutelage of Florence Scott, one of our original founders. Florence also trained Nina Jonio, one of our former practitioners, as well as several others through the years at the center. Susan has been practicing for about 18yrs now.

She was with us for 13 years of those years, when she decided to join Nehemiah's Ranch for youth's, where she could do more one-one with the clients. She was with Nehemiah's Ranch up until 2008 when they had to close their doors (for unknown reasons), she then started out on her own and became an independent neurodevelopmental practitioner.
